Benefits of HAN Scholarships
For bachelor students:
- HAN Holland Scholarship: You will get € 2,500 for this scholarship in the first semester and € 2,500 in the second semester. For the following three years of studies, you can get € 2,500 a year. You must continue earning 45 credits each year to receive this.
- Honors Scholarship: The honor scholarship is different. There’s no need for you to apply. The academic board’s students chosen for the study program have excelled academically in their first year.
Who is qualified?
Students who fulfilled the minimal criteria were not awarded a HAN Holland scholarship. In the second year, the payout begins at €2,500. You can then get € 2,500 for each subsequent year of study. You must earn the necessary 45 credits per year to receive this.
For Master Students:
- HAN Holland Scholarship: In the first semester, you get € 2,500, and in the second semester, you get € 2,500.
- Honors Scholarship: The honors scholarship is different. There’s no need for you to apply. The academic board chooses students that excelled in their first semester of the study program.
Who is qualified?
Students who fulfilled the minimal criteria were not awarded a HAN Holland scholarship. The Honors scholarship comes from a single 2,500-euro payment in the second semester.
Eligibility Criteria for HAN Scholarships
- You are a citizen of a nation outside the EEA or the EU.
- You have never before been enrolled in a degree program at a Dutch university or university of applied sciences.
- You have been granted admission to HAN’s full-time degree program taught in English.
- You have at least a 6.5 IELTS score, a 90 TOEFL iBT score, or a Cambridge Certificate (CAE or CPE)
Documents Requirement for HAN Scholarships
- A letter of motivation. Why you will succeed as a HAN student is explained in this section.
- A little video of you. 3 minutes tops. Talk about the following:
- Describe who you are and what you are good at.
- What would your friends or past teachers say about you?
- Tell them about the academic program you have selected at HAN.
- Assume you are a member of a team. What part would you play and why, given your personality and experience
- What are your professional goals? What and where do you envision yourself to be in ten years, professionally speaking?
- Your CV.
